Summary:
The 73949 zip code area is home to two small schools - Texhoma Elementary School and Texhoma High School, both part of the Texhoma school district. While the schools have seen fluctuations in their statewide rankings over the years, they face significant challenges in terms of academic performance, attendance, and socioeconomic factors.
Texhoma Elementary School has experienced ups and downs in its statewide ranking, going from a high of 110 out of 846 Oklahoma elementary schools in 2010-2011 to a low of 783 out of 957 in 2014-2015, before improving to 142 out of 646 in the most recent 2020-2021 school year. Similarly, Texhoma High School has seen its ranking vary from a high of 139 out of 431 Oklahoma high schools in 2023-2024 to a low of 428 out of 463 in the most recent 2024-2025 school year.
Both schools have significantly lower proficiency rates compared to state averages across English Language Arts, Math, and Science, with Texhoma Elementary at 11% proficiency in ELA (compared to 26% state average) and Texhoma High at 7% proficiency in 11th grade ELA (compared to 37% state average). Additionally, the schools have high chronic absenteeism rates of 19%, and a large percentage of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, with 48.55% at the elementary school and 60% at the high school. These factors likely contribute to the academic challenges faced by the schools in this area.
